Factors Affecting Cost
- Pad Size: Larger pads require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Concrete Type: Different types of concrete, such as standard, high-strength, or decorative, have varying costs.
- Thickness: Thicker pads require more concrete and reinforcement, leading to higher expenses.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including grading and excavation, can affect costs.
- Reinforcement: Adding rebar or wire mesh for additional strength will increase the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ary, impacting the total cost of installation.
- Permits and Inspections: Local permits and required inspections can add to the overall expense.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Concrete Pad (10x10 ft) |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Reinforcement (Rebar) | $200 - $500 |
Decorative Finishes | $5 - $15 per sq. ft. |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Labor | $50 - $100 per hour |
